Abstract
Emotional intelligence is essential when socializing and adapting to the environment, itallows us to understand how we can influence in an adaptive and intelligent way the
emotions of people and of ourselves. In the Peruvian university environment, it is
important that students have skills to manage their emotions and face adverse situations.
Therefore, an emotional intelligence model is proposed to improve resilience in
university students. The research is of an experimental, quantitative and quasiexperimental
design, the technique used was the survey and as an instrument the
questionnaire that was applied to 58 students about the variables emotional intelligence
and resilience. The results show that 27.59% indicate that their level of interpersonal
intelligence is regular, 39.66% indicate that their level of intrapersonal intelligence is
regular and 32.76% indicate that their level of adaptability is bad. Therefore, adequate
emotional intelligence and resilience in students will allow them to handle skills such as
interpersonal and intrapersonal intelligence, adaptability, perseverance and selfconfidence
when facing situations of change in their environment.
